Takamaka Grankaz
How it's made
Grankaz truly represents Seychelles Rum, showcasing our ageing and blending craft. Traditional pot distilled Seychelles cane rum aged in medium toast new French oak is blended with our three year old ex-bourbon molasses rum and 8 year old Bajan Foursquare molasses rum. Bottled at 51.6% no sugar or colouring and only very lightly filtered.
Tasting note
This rum has a herbaceous and slightly floral nose, hints of toasted vanilla followed by silky and smooth stewed fruits and butterscotch characters. The layers of complexity give way to a long finish with notes of toasted oak.
How to serve
Perfect neat.
Takamaka Rum
Takamaka Rum is a premium rum from Seychelles, produced by the Trois Frères Distillery, located on the idyllic island of Mahé. Founded in 2002 by brothers Richard and Bernard d'Offay, Takamaka is named after a popular bay on the island and the brand has quickly gained a global reputation for its unique flavour and quality.
The distillery is set amidst the lush tropical surroundings of Seychelles, where the sugar cane is locally grown and carefully processed. A special feature of Takamaka Rum is the combination of traditional Creole distillation techniques and modern production processes. The rum is made from both local sugarcane and imported molasses, creating a rich and layered flavour.
Takamaka Rum is known for its tropical and fruity notes, complemented by hints of vanilla, caramel and spices. The rums are aged in French and American oak barrels, which ensures a smooth and refined taste. The range varies from white and dark rums to special matured expressions, which perfectly capture the vibrant spirit of Seychelles. Takamaka is not only a symbol of Creole culture, but also an internationally loved rum that stands for quality and authenticity.
